Output 8b58cd50daeb0f7abae9050f6d6d6039f2c59777317935bdccdafa7bc1324f5e:0

value
9800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ea2bc0802f277966574cac152886c481b4a0e01 OP_EQUAL
address
3G9odqueee4b9TufdfGHEDogDqj3ntVzkG
transaction
8b58cd50daeb0f7abae9050f6d6d6039f2c59777317935bdccdafa7bc1324f5e
confirmations
89072
spent
true